The city will have a new annual event on its calendar in November – The Mangalore Marathon 2022. Starting this year, the event will be conducted in the month of November with the aim to encourage residents of Mangalore to live healthier lifestyles and improve their fitness by running.
Mangalore Runners Club, a nonprofit running club based in Mangalore announced the first edition of the Mangalore Marathon. The launch event was held at 7:15 am on Sunday 31st July at Decathlon, Bharath Mall
Akshy Sridhar, IAS, Commissioner, Mangaluru City Corporation & Prashant Kumar Mishra, IAS, MD MESCOM, both passionate runners were the guests of honor, who unveiled the logo of Niveus Mangalore Marathon 2022. The official website of the event www.mangaloremarathon.com was
inaugurated and Mr.Akshy and Mr. Prashant were the first to register for the upcoming marathon in the half marathon category. In his address, Akshy Sridhar claimed that running is one of the most accessible sports and that it brings out the best in individuals. Running may be done anywhere, at any time of year, and requires no particular equipment. He emphasized that sport should be given the same importance as jobs in our daily life. Suyog Shetty, CEO Niveus Solutions Pvt Ltd, Jithesh Rai, Store Manager, Decathlon, Ajith A, President, Mangalore Runners Club, and Abhilash Dominic, Race Director, Niveus Mangalore Marathon 2022 were present. The event was compered by Amitha D’Souza.
The first edition of the marathon titled Niveus Mangalore Marathon 2022 will take place on November 6, 2022, at Mangala Stadium. It aims to create a long-term community-focused running event that encourages athletes of all levels to run, live a healthy life, and improve their personal fitness. Niveus Solutions Pvt Ltd. is the event’s title sponsor, with Decathlon as a cosponsor. The run will include the scenic Tannirbhavi beach road, which stretches beyond the breathtaking horizon view, a shaded trail, and city highways. The event will have four categories – Half Marathon (21.1K), 10K,5K & 2K Gammath run/walk designed to accommodate all levels of runners, from beginners to seasoned athletes. Cash prizes will be awarded to the top three male and female runners in three age categories.

The Mangalore Runners Club is a diverse group of runners of all ages and abilities from various walks of life in Mangalore. It was founded by a group of six people with a mutual passion for running. The group’s goal is to bring together runners from all over town who want to live a fit and healthy lifestyle together. In just a year, this club has grown to over 150 members. The club’s runners have competed in several well-known marathons, including the Tata Mumbai Marathon, the Ooty Ultra Marathon, Bengaluru Marathon and the Dandeli Ultra Marathon. A member of MRC has run 100 half marathons in a row, which is an impressive feat for us. MRC has participated in the Hundred Days of Running challenge for several years. In addition, our team assisted in the organization of Mangalore’s first marathon, The Big Balipu, in 2016, the Big Balipu Virtual Marathon in 2020, and the TCS 10k virtual run in Mangalore. Every Sunday, the group organizes a run, coaches new runners, provides monthly training plans, and organizes and participates in running events across the country.
